  • Abstract
    We have investigated low-temperature electronic states of the organic conductors, α-(BEDT-TTF)2MHg(SCN)4 [M = K, Rb and NH4] in terms of 13C-NMR and dc susceptibility measurements. For all the compounds, the overall temperature dependence of 1/(T1T) scales to that of χs2 except below the nesting instability. For M = Rb and K salts, the 1/(T1T) decreased below the transition temperatures without line-broadening or relaxation enhancement. The spectra changed from complicated lines to an apparently simple Pake doublet below the nesting temperatures. All of the NMR data are successfully explained by reduction of the electronic density-of states below the transition but do not have any sign of magnetic order.
